Purpose statement
This module describes the skills, knowledge and attitudes required to identify electrical
service needs, size needed commercial/industrial electrical installation and apparatus, to
install, repair and maintain electrical devices and equipment. It also describes the
knowledge, skills and attitudes required to design and install service engine standby
generator for working premises. It is designed for trainees pursuing Diploma in Electrical
Technology.
By the end of this module, the trainee will be able to perform identification of electrical
service needs, sizing needed commercial electrical installation and apparatus,
installation, maintainance and repair of commercial electrical devices and equipment. In
addition, the trainee will be able to design, install and service engine standby generator
for working premises.

Module purpose statement
This module describes the skills, knowledge and attitudes required to identify, select and control electromechanical actuators including relays, contactors and other electromechanical elements used in electrical circuitry like machinery, elevators and various motion systems. It is designed for trainees pursuing Advanced Diploma in Electrical Technology.
By the end of this module, the trainee will be able to identify, select, install, control, troubleshoot and maintain the electromechanical actuators for an industrial application.The general learning objectives of the whole modules
